As a Client Banking Service Professional, you play a crucial role in enhancing the client journey by delivering exceptional service to Charles Schwab Bank clients. Your expertise will cover various banking products and services, including deposit accounts, online account management, bill pay, money movement, mobile banking, and debit cards.

What you bring
Required Qualifications
- Minimum of 1 year of professional experience, which can include unpaid roles, volunteer work, internships, or similar positions
- Capability to work in the office between 75% - 100% of the time as necessary
Preferred Qualifications
- Excellent client service capabilities, managing around 40 – 60 inbound calls daily while showcasing empathy and problem-solving proficiency
- Proficient in active listening and engaging in open-ended conversations to grasp the client's financial requirements comprehensively
- Commitment to addressing various complex client concerns through technology and collaboration with Schwab's business partners to identify efficient solutions to meet client objectives
- Ability to establish lasting rapport with clients over the phone to develop enduring relationships with Schwab
- Keenness to be part of a supportive and cooperative team
- Strong attention to detail to comply with extensive bank regulations, protocols, and directives
- Enthusiasm to learn from a dedicated team leader dedicated to assisting you in achieving specific performance targets by providing guidance and experiential learning opportunities
- Proven track record of navigating multiple software applications
